This week on Oh My Dog, our resident dog expert Simon Parry-Moreno is back to answer your questions. Why does one dog refuse to eat from a bowl? Why does another sprint across roads? Can moving house make a dog anxious? And what exactly is going on inside our dogs' minds? Jack , Seann and Sara also share their own dog dramas - from Mildred's banana-fuelled escape to Dolly's hatred of windy weather. Plus, Simon gives us updates on Leia and the ever-growing Strudel, explains why dogs love destroying soft toys, and reveals what our four-legged friends would actually eat in the wild. Broadcaster and animal advocate Kirsty Gallacher joins Jack, Seann and Sara to introduce her beloved dogs Bertie the French Bulldog and Frank the rescue Cocker Spaniel. She shares her growing passion for animal welfare, rescue charities and campaigning for change. Plus, Seann battles a house full of Wi-Fi boosters, survives an AdBlue disaster, and the team swap stories about thunderstorms, rescue dogs and why some dogs really do rule the house. This week, Jack, Seann and Sara catch up on life with Dolly, Mildred and Juniper, including a worrying moment when Juniper gave Sara quite a scare. The gang discuss whether all dogs can actually swim, why some breeds struggle in the water, and the surprising discovery of a dog swimming school. Plus, an update on stolen cockapoo Rufus, the big push Fetcher Dog needs, and some genuinely encouraging news from the campaign to end beagle breeding for animal testing. There's also talk of Edinburgh Fringe memories, empty comedy clubs, and why Jack once ended up out of pocket after refunding an audience.
